Default Overdrive solenoid wire in instrument panel

I'm wrapping up the wiring on the fold down instrument panel and I have one wire unconnected and I don't understand why it is there. It is yellow with purple tracer and has a ring connector as if it is supposed to connect to the headlight switch. It exits the loom at the same place as the headlights, side lights, etc.
I have several wiring diagrams and they all say this color combo should be for the overdrive solenoid. I confirmed that it is connected to the yellow/purple wire that is where the overdrive switch will be. Why is this wire in the instrument panel? None of the wiring diagrams show this connecting to anything on the panel.
This is more out of curiosity since I don't need the overdrive solenoid wires.

On my schematics the YP comes from Overdrive Circuit to light switch (in to 2 and out on 4) and then to the OD Warning Light. Straight through switch when lights off and through resistor for dimming warning light when lights turned on

This is making sense now. The overdrive warning light dims when the lights are on. Thank you for the picture!
